[发明专利]一种视频监控系统中多路视频播放自动分屏的实现方法在审
申请号: | 201910600565.6 | 申请日: | 2019-07-04 |
公开(公告)号: | CN110392295A | 公开(公告)日: | 2019-10-29 |
发明(设计)人: | 张婕;杨劲松;夏银生;熊超;王晓娟;程永照;罗静;陶小龙 | 申请(专利权)人: | 安徽富煌科技股份有限公司 |
主分类号: | H04N21/431 | 分类号: | H04N21/431;G06F3/14;H04N21/485 |
代理公司: | 合肥律众知识产权代理有限公司 34147 | 代理人: | 冯慧云 |
地址: | 230000 安徽省合*** | 国省代码: | 安徽;34 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种视频监控系统中多路视频播放自动分屏的实现方法,属于视频分屏技术领域,包括以下步骤:S1、播放容器的宽高计算;S2、播放容器的动态绑定;S3、选择分屏模式;S4、智能分屏模式;S5、非智能分屏模式;S6、动态计算视频宽高;S7、视频多路分屏。本方法提供用户两种分屏模式,智能分屏模式可以自动分屏,非智能分屏模式需要用户设置分屏数量而者最终结果相同,提高了用户的操作性,根据用户选择的分屏模式,计算屏幕大小,采用动态获取播放窗体大小计算各分频宽高,并对分屏进行左浮动布局,从而达到对屏幕进行等比例划分的效果,来满足用户进行多路视频同时观看的需求。 | ||
搜索关键词: | 分屏模式 分屏 播放 多路视频 视频监控系统 非智能 视频 大小计算 动态绑定 动态获取 动态计算 视频多路 用户设置 最终结果 屏幕 智能 窗体 分频 浮动 观看 | ||
【主权项】:
1.一种视频监控系统中多路视频播放自动分屏的实现方法,其特征在于:包括以下步骤:S1、播放容器的宽高计算:利用基于javascript的高宽函数计算最外层播放容器的高度和宽度数值;S2、播放容器的动态绑定:对步骤S1计算的数值进行监听,在播放容器窗口变化时调用重设容器的宽度和高度函数,实时计算出变化后播放容器的高度和宽度,获取变化后播放容器的高宽并且判断播放容器当前是否处于全屏;S3、选择分屏模式:通过设置智能分屏和非智能分屏两种模式供用户选择;S4、智能分屏模式:用户选择智能分屏模式时,系统获取智能分屏指令,通过计算播放视频的数量和尺寸判断是否能分屏,若能则选择分屏数量;S5、非智能分屏模式:用户选择非智能分屏模式时,系统获取用户选择的分屏数量,调用最外层播放容器的高度和宽度数值,通过动态计算各分屏大小,将播放的视频分屏铺满整个播放容器;S6、动态计算视频宽高:将步骤S5播放的视频的宽度和高度绑定在宽高计算函数上,并且设置宽高计算间隔,当窗体监听事件触发时调用函数即可动态改变分屏大小;S7、视频多路分屏:完成多路视频自动分屏的效果。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于安徽富煌科技股份有限公司,未经安徽富煌科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201910600565.6/,转载请声明来源钻瓜专利网。